Falling Tree Limb Claims Life of Driver in West Whiteland Township
WEST WHITELAND TWP β A deadly accident on South Ship Road near Stonegate Court in West Whiteland Township claimed the life of a 30-year-old woman on Thursday morning. The crash occurred shortly before 10 a.m. when a falling tree limb struck the roof of a 2011 Chevrolet Suburban traveling southbound. The impact forced the vehicle to continue a short distance before it came to a stop in the northbound lanes.
Emergency responders from the West Whiteland Police Department, local fire department, and ambulance services worked to assist the two occupants of the vehicle. Tragically, the driver succumbed to her injuries at the scene. A juvenile passenger was transported to Paoli Memorial Hospital for treatment, though details on their condition were not disclosed.
Authorities are investigating the incident, which appears to have been caused by the falling tree limb. The names of the individuals involved have not been released
Historic Photo Contest Winner to Light Calnβs Holiday Tree

CALN TWP β This Sunday, Caln Township will host its annual tree-lighting ceremony, with lifelong resident Romaine Dunlap serving as the official Tree Lighter. Dunlap was selected for the honor after submitting a photo from the late 1800s during the townshipβs Historic Photo Contest last month. The photograph, which depicts her ancestors, the family of James Kearns, standing outside their home on South Caln Road, was recognized as the oldest submission.
The Kearns-Dunlap house, still in excellent condition, stands as a testament to the areaβs history. Residents can learn more about the homeβs storied past through resources provided by the township. The event, beginning at 5:00 p.m., offers an opportunity for the community to gather, celebrate the season, and reflect on its heritage.
Popcorn Story Time Returns to Chester Springs Library

CHESTER SPRINGS, PA β This Friday, December 6, the Chester Springs Library invites families to a special Popcorn Story Time, beginning at 10:30 a.m. The event will feature an interactive storytelling session designed to engage young readers and their caregivers.
